Output dc5826f8d64c0d64debf9565610f32919c820ded7fa5fb5622915510cb758517:12

value
468600
script pubkey
OP_0 OP_PUSHBYTES_20 8b7b2e23870302d44a793bc7d478904fc40af211
address
bc1q3dajugu8qvpdgjne80rag7ysflzq4us3ruxwt0
transaction
dc5826f8d64c0d64debf9565610f32919c820ded7fa5fb5622915510cb758517
confirmations
171402
spent
true